Full Job Description

More people than ever are living with diabetes or are at risk of developing it. At Diabetes UK, we are committed to driving change so that everyone affected by diabetes can live well and for longer.

We are looking for an exceptional and inspiring leader to join Diabetes UK as our National Director for Wales-a rare opportunity to make a lasting impact on the health and lives of people across the nation.

This high-profile role will provide strategic leadership across Wales, influencing policy and driving improvements in care and outcomes. You will work closely with Welsh Government, the NHS, and partners across the voluntary sector to tackle health inequalities and ensure that the needs of people living with or at risk of diabetes are at the centre of decision-making. You will also act as a key spokesperson for Diabetes UK in Wales, building strong relationships with senior stakeholders and ensuring our voice is heard at the highest levels

This role is as much about leading people and delivering outcomes as it is about strategy. You will lead and inspire a multidisciplinary team across policy, communities and health systems, fostering a high-performing and collaborative culture. You will also play a key role in empowering your team, building capability, and creating an inclusive environment where colleagues feel motivated, supported and able to deliver meaningful, lasting change.
